Overview of Online GST Registration in India
Businesses in India that generate more than Rs 40 lakhs in revenue annually must register for GST online. According to Indian law, the registration process for the Goods and Services Tax (GST) is a distinct taxable provision. It entails utilizing the official portal to submit the required information and papers online. Usually, it takes two to six working days to finish the registration. Businesses are assigned a unique GST identification number upon registration. For businesses operating nationwide, this online technique simplifies the taxing process by ensuring adherence to GST requirements.

Types of GST Registration in India
Different types of GST registration exist, such as casual, regular, non-resident, and e-commerce operators. Every day, non-resident taxpayers and e-commerce owners must register for GST regardless of the revenue criteria.
● Casual Taxable Person
According to the GST Act, a casual taxable person is a person who periodically offers goods or services in a State or Union territory where the entity does not have a regular place of business. Therefore, under the GST, anyone running temporary companies at fairs, exhibitions, or seasonal operations would be considered casual taxable individuals.
● Non-Resident Taxable Persons
Any person, corporation, or organization that offers goods or services but does not maintain a permanent residence or place of business in India is referred to as a non-resident taxable person (NRI) under the GST. Therefore, any foreign person, business, or organization that supplies goods or services to India would be considered non-resident taxable and must comply with all Indian GST requirements.
● E-Commerce Operators
An e-commerce operator owns, manages, or controls a digital or electronic facility or platform for electronic trade. Therefore, everyone who sells online can be regarded as an e-commerce Operator and must register for GST, regardless of company revenue.
